The Benefits of Treadmill Workouts: A Comprehensive Overview

Treadmill workouts offer a plethora of physical and mental health benefits, making them an excellent choice for individuals of all fitness levels. These benefits include:

  • Cardiovascular Health: Running or walking on a treadmill strengthens the heart and improves overall cardiovascular health.
  • Weight Management: Treadmill workouts burn calories and promote weight loss.
  • Muscle Building: Treadmill workouts engage various muscle groups, including the legs, core, and arms.
  • Bone Density: Regular treadmill use helps maintain and improve bone density, reducing the risk of osteoporosis.
  • Mood Enhancement: Exercise on a treadmill releases endorphins, which have mood-boosting effects.

Choosing the Right Treadmill for Your Needs: Essential Considerations

Choosing the right treadmill is crucial for maximizing your workout experience. Consider the following factors:

  • Motor Power: The motor power determines the treadmill’s speed and incline capabilities. Choose a motor power that suits your fitness level and workout goals.
  • Belt Size: The belt size should be large enough to accommodate your stride comfortably.
  • Incline: Inclines simulate hill running and provide additional workout intensity. Choose a treadmill with an incline range that meets your fitness needs.
  • Features: Look for treadmills with features such as heart rate monitoring, pre-programmed workouts, and Bluetooth connectivity.
  • Budget: Treadmills vary in price depending on their features and quality. Set a realistic budget and compare options within your price range.

Setting Up and Maintaining Your Treadmill: Step-by-Step Instructions

Proper setup and maintenance ensure the longevity and safety of your treadmill. Follow these steps:

  • Assembly: Assemble the treadmill according to the manufacturer’s instructions.
  • Placement: Place the treadmill on a level surface in a well-ventilated area.
  • Lubrication: Lubricate the treadmill belt regularly to reduce friction and extend its lifespan.
  • Cleaning: Clean the treadmill after each use to prevent dust and debris buildup.
  • Calibration: Calibrate the treadmill periodically to ensure accurate speed and distance readings.

Treadmill Workout Plans: Customizing Your Fitness Journey

Tailoring your treadmill workouts to your fitness goals is essential. Consider these tips:

  • Warm-up: Start with a light walk or jog to prepare your body for the workout.
  • Interval Training: Alternate between high-intensity bursts and recovery periods to improve cardiovascular fitness and burn fat.
  • Hill Workouts: Use the treadmill’s incline feature to simulate hill running and increase muscle engagement.
  • Cool-down: End your workout with a light walk or jog to help your body recover.
  • Progression: Gradually increase the intensity and duration of your workouts over time to challenge yourself and achieve your fitness goals.

Safety Precautions for Treadmill Use: Avoiding Common Pitfalls

Treadmill use can be safe and enjoyable if proper precautions are taken:

  • Wear proper footwear: Use running shoes with good cushioning and support.
  • Hold onto the handrails: Hold onto the handrails when starting, stopping, or adjusting the speed or incline.
  • Be aware of your surroundings: Pay attention to your surroundings and avoid distractions.
  • Listen to your body: Stop exercising if you feel pain or discomfort.
  • Cool down: Always cool down after a workout to prevent muscle cramps and soreness.

Troubleshooting Common Treadmill Issues: Practical Solutions

Addressing common treadmill issues promptly ensures a smooth workout experience. Here are some practical solutions:

  • Belt slipping: Tighten the belt according to the manufacturer’s instructions.
  • Motor overheating: Unplug the treadmill and let it cool down before using it again.
  • Erratic speed: Check the calibration and make sure the treadmill is placed on a level surface.
  • Noisy operation: Lubricate the treadmill belt and check for any loose parts.
  • Electrical problems: Contact a qualified electrician for assistance.
